Publication form CD-ROM - CD-ROM Action Inženýrská mechanika 2002 Event date 13.05.2002-16.05.2002 VEvent location Svratka Country CZ - Czech Republic Event type WRD Language eng - English Country CZ - Czech Republic Keywords open channel flow ; ultrasound velocity measurement ; discharge coefficient Subject RIV BK - Fluid Dynamics R&D Projects GA103/00/1620 GA ČR - Czech Science Foundation (CSF) Annotation The paper deals with an open channel flow around model of a bridge when the water depth is higher than height of the bridge opening. Both the pressured flow through bridge opening and free surgace flow over the model were studied. For both cases discharge coefficients were determined and for overflowed model also the velocity profiles were measured to evaluate the ratio of discharges going below and over the bridge model.
